==Support of Ukrainian culture==

Puluj is also known for his contribution in promoting [[Ukraine|Ukrainian culture]]. He actively supported opening of a Ukrainian university in [[Lviv]] and published articles to support Ukrainian language. Together with [[Panteleimon Kulish|P. Kulish]] and [[Ivan Nechuy-Levytsky|I. Nechuy-Levytsky]] he translated [[Gospels]] and [[Psalter]] into [[Ukrainian language|Ukrainian]].{{fact|date=January 2021}} Being a professor, Puluj organized scholarships for Ukrainian students in [[Austria-Hungary]].<ref>{{Cite web |last=Shkarlat |first=Kateryna |orig-date=November 19, 2023 |title=Ivan Puluj: Outstanding Ukrainian who discovered X-rays long before Röntgen |url=https://newsukraine.rbc.ua/news/ivan-puluj-incredible-facts-about-outstanding-1700345952.html |access-date=2024-08-21 |website=RBC-Ukraine |language=en}}</ref>

The World Association of Roentgenologists was created in 2018 in Lviv city in honor of Ivan Puluj.
